Ensure the platform offers reliable streaming quality with minimal latency.

When it comes to hosting a successful webcast, one of the most crucial factors to consider is the streaming quality and latency of the platform you choose. In today’s fast-paced digital world, where attention spans are short and expectations are high, ensuring a seamless and reliable streaming experience is paramount.

Reliable streaming quality refers to the ability of the webcast platform to deliver a smooth and uninterrupted stream of audio and video content. Nothing frustrates viewers more than constant buffering, freezing screens, or distorted audio. These issues not only disrupt the flow of the event but also diminish the overall user experience.

Additionally, minimal latency is equally important. Latency refers to the delay between when something happens in real-time and when it is seen or heard by viewers on their devices. High latency can lead to awkward delays in interactions, making conversations feel disjointed and unnatural. It can also hinder real-time engagement features like polls or Q&A sessions.

To ensure a positive user experience and engagement during your webcast, it’s essential to choose a platform that prioritizes reliable streaming quality with minimal latency. Look for platforms that use robust content delivery networks (CDNs) to distribute your stream efficiently across multiple servers worldwide. CDNs help minimize buffering by reducing the distance between viewers and content servers.

Furthermore, consider platforms that offer adaptive bitrate streaming (ABR). ABR adjusts video quality based on each viewer’s internet connection speed, ensuring smooth playback regardless of varying network conditions. This feature guarantees that viewers with slower connections can still enjoy your webcast without interruptions.

Before committing to a webcast platform, thoroughly test its streaming capabilities. Run trial broadcasts or demos to assess how well it handles different internet speeds and devices. Pay attention to any buffering issues or delays during these tests as they may indicate potential problems during your actual event.

Ensure the platform is secure and compliant with data privacy regulations such as GDPR or CCPA.

When it comes to choosing a webcast platform, one crucial tip to keep in mind is ensuring the platform’s security and compliance with data privacy regulations. With the increasing emphasis on data protection and privacy, it is essential to select a platform that prioritizes these aspects.

Data privacy regulations such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in Europe or the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) in the United States have been implemented to safeguard individuals’ personal information. These regulations outline strict guidelines on how organizations handle, store, and process data.

By selecting a webcast platform that is compliant with these regulations, you can rest assured that your attendees’ personal information will be handled securely and in accordance with legal requirements. This includes obtaining proper consent for data collection, implementing robust security measures to protect against unauthorized access or breaches, and providing transparency regarding data usage.

A secure webcast platform should utilize encryption technologies to safeguard sensitive information transmitted during live events. Additionally, it should have secure access controls in place to ensure that only authorized individuals can access the content.

Verifying a platform’s compliance can be done by reviewing their privacy policy and terms of service. Look for explicit mentions of GDPR or CCPA compliance and ensure they align with your specific requirements.

Consider the cost of using the webcast platform before selecting one for your needs.

Consider the Cost: Choosing the Right Webcast Platform for Your Needs

When it comes to selecting a webcast platform, there are numerous factors to consider. One critical aspect that should not be overlooked is the cost associated with using the platform. Understanding and evaluating the pricing structure will help you make an informed decision and ensure that it aligns with your budget.

Different webcast platforms offer various pricing models, so it’s essential to explore your options thoroughly. Some platforms charge a flat fee for each event, while others may have a subscription-based model or charge based on the number of attendees. It’s crucial to assess your specific needs and determine which pricing structure best suits your requirements.

Before finalizing your decision, take the time to evaluate what features and services are included in each pricing plan. Some platforms may offer additional functionalities such as analytics, branding customization, or technical support at higher price tiers. Understanding these offerings will help you assess whether they align with your goals and justify any additional costs.

It’s also worth considering scalability when assessing costs. If you anticipate hosting events of varying sizes or expect growth in attendance numbers over time, ensure that the platform’s pricing structure accommodates this scalability without significant financial implications.

While cost is an important factor, it should not be the sole determining factor in choosing a webcast platform. It’s crucial to strike a balance between affordability and the quality of service provided. Evaluate each platform’s reliability, ease of use, customer support, and overall user experience alongside their pricing structure.

Additionally, consider any potential hidden costs that may arise during or after using the platform. These could include charges for additional bandwidth usage or fees for add-on features that are not included in the base price. Being aware of these potential expenses upfront will help you avoid any surprises down the line.

Check if there are any limitations on bandwidth or storage capacity when using a particular webcast platform for your event or broadcast needs.

When it comes to choosing the right webcast platform for your event or broadcast needs, there are several factors to consider. One crucial aspect to pay attention to is the limitations on bandwidth and storage capacity offered by the platform.

Bandwidth refers to the amount of data that can be transmitted over an internet connection within a given time frame. It determines how smoothly your webcast will stream and how many participants can join without experiencing buffering or lagging issues. Before selecting a webcast platform, it’s essential to check if they provide sufficient bandwidth for your expected audience size and streaming requirements.

Similarly, storage capacity is another important consideration. Depending on the nature of your event, you may need to store recordings of your webcasts for future reference or on-demand viewing. Some platforms offer limited storage space, while others may have restrictions on how long recordings are stored or charge additional fees for extra storage. Understanding your storage needs and ensuring that the platform can accommodate them is crucial.

By checking these limitations upfront, you can avoid potential issues during your event or broadcast. Insufficient bandwidth could lead to a poor streaming experience for participants, causing frustration and impacting engagement levels. Limited storage capacity might force you to delete older recordings prematurely or pay extra fees for additional storage, which can disrupt your workflow and budget.

To make an informed decision, thoroughly review the specifications provided by different webcast platforms. Look for information about bandwidth allocation and whether they offer scalable solutions that can accommodate larger audiences if needed. Assess their storage options and policies to ensure they align with your long-term recording needs.
